These Sickle bar mowers are made for compact tractors. The main duty is trimming around and mowing ditch banks. Sickle bar mowers are not intended to be used as bush hogs but can handle 1/2" stuff on a limited basis. We do not make a 7' because many of the CUT's could not accommodate that size.

CCI, when the sickle mower is mounted, does the cutting edge start at the outside edge of the wheel, or is it inbound of that. I'm trying to figure how far it will actually cut beyond the outside edge of the rear tire on a BX 2200.

Also, approximately what angle can the bar be used? If you are riding beside the ditch (or in my case the pond) will the cutter angle downward? If yes, do you know the angle?

The Super 65 will start cutting at the outside of the rear tire. It will mow 70 degree vertical and 20 degree below horizontal. The cutterbar cuts 5'5". This mower is designed for compact tractors.

DK_Farms,
The owner wasn't a dealer and had nothing else to sell that I'm aware of. I had two or three other calls of interest other than the one I bought. While I was driving south to get the mower I had a call from someone in N Louisiana with a IH 1300 for $300 and another guy (I think near Jonesville) with a JD 350. If you're looking I would recommend the "wanted" ad because it seems like by the time you call after seeing the ad in the bulletin someone else has bought it. If it's a deal the first caller is going to buy it! I've noticed the the MS market bulletin has listed several in the past few months and would recommend posting a wanted ad there if you're willing to drive a little.
